Note: The previous C-based Notification Mailer is obsolete in this release. Also, Java-based notification mailers do not use text files to define configuration parameters and tags; instead, all configuration settings are entered in Workflow Manager.
Note: Oracle Workflow no longer supports the old MAPI-compliant mailer because the Microsoft Outlook E-mail Security Update that was released on June 7, 2000 desupports the MAPI Common Messaging Calls (CMC) interface used by that mailer. (See: OL2000: Developer Information About the Outlook E-mail Security Update.) Oracle Workflow also no longer supports parsing an inbound SMTP file for response processing with UNIX Sendmail. Instead, the new architecture of the Java-based Workflow Notification Mailer uses an IMAP inbox for response processing. The same Workflow Notification Mailer can be used regardless of the platform on which you deploy it.
